Auto Europe

  • EUROPE
  • DRIVALIA PORTUGAL CUSTOMER REVIEWS

    • 6.2
    • 5.6
    • 5.8
    • 6.2
    • Value for Money
    • Efficiency of Counter Staff
    • Condition of the Vehicle
    • Expediency of Drop-off
    October 19
    The instructions to meet the rep weren't clear and we went all around the airport trying to...

    DRIVALIA PORTUGAL Car Rental Reviews

    Average Rating for Drivalia :